How Tnpsc Image Compressor Platforms Operate

Modern compression technologies use algorithms to optimize digital files efficiently. Tools such as Tnpsc photo compressor may apply lossy or lossless compression techniques.

Lossy compression removes less important image data to Tnpsc photo compress achieve smaller files. Lossless methods maintain image integrity while improving storage efficiency.

The choice of compression method depends on the intended use of the image. Online gaming platforms typically prioritize both efficiency and visual clarity.
